Extra Hours!
After the main festival was restricted to a mere four-hour duration, we asked the local community to tell us about other events happening on May 9th, so that attendees would find additional reasons to come visit Waltham. These have become “Extra Hours” for the day!
Note that all these events are being run by the individual organizations, not the Watch City Steampunk Festival. If you have questions, you should contact them directly.

Make Your Own Golem
Join Waltham’s Temple Beth Israel to make your own Golem of Prague! Make your own “Golem” with clay, eat turn of the century Jewish foods, and hear the story that inspired Frankenstein all on our front lawn!
Come to 25 Harvard St between 4:30pm and 6:30pm. It is recommended that you arrive no later than 6:00pm to have enough time for the activity.
